Output 1579702b9877a20de562972de6fddc4453a2fd5b3478083477d70f58f9877141:1

value
1138906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f26cd968b7ecac6518a47f9493ec684ae68be61 OP_EQUAL
address
3DHLDzTDayxfgwyGDb4HJz1zLxnjTpPjRw
transaction
1579702b9877a20de562972de6fddc4453a2fd5b3478083477d70f58f9877141
confirmations
290543
spent
true